						<title>Review the Effectiveness of Ergonomic Interventions in Reducing the Incidence of Musculoskeletal Problems of Workers in Fatal Truck Assembly Hall</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=345&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;p style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ction: &lt;/strong&gt;Different studies around the world have shown that Work-Related Musculoskeletal Disorders (WMSDs) are the causes of lost time, absenteeism, and disability. The purpose of this study was to investigate the prevalence rate of musculoskeletal disorders (WMSDs) and to evaluate their ergonomic risk factors and determine the effect of ergonomic intervention on awkward postures among workers of Saipa Diesel Truck manufacturing plants.&lt;br&gt;
&lt;strong&gt;Methods:&lt;/strong&gt; This interventional study (Before-after) was conducted on 130 workers of 2 largest truck-manufacturing plants in Iran. The prevalence rate of MSDs and ergonomic risk factors was assessed by valid and reliable translated Body Map Questionnaire (BM) and Quick Exposure Check (QEC) method, respectively.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; According to Body Map results, 87.5% of participants had MSDs at least in one of their eleven body regions during the previous year, before study. The highest prevalence rate of MSDs was observed in lower back (51.5%) and foot area (18.5%). Chi square test revealed that the prevalence rate of MSDs was higher among those with higher QEC risk level (P &lt; 0.001). Results also indicated the significant effect of ergonomic interventions on reducing the prevalence rate of MSDs and QEC risk level (P &lt; 0.001).&lt;br&gt;
&lt;strong&gt;Conclusions:&lt;/strong&gt; This study showed that the prevalence rate of MSDs and QEC risk levels among workers was significantly high. Therefore, it can be mentioned that the need for early ergonomic interventions is felt in all industrial units of these truck-manufacturing plants.&lt;/p&gt;

						<title>An Investigation of the Relationship between Psychosocial Work Factors and Fatigue among Nurses</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=312&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;p style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ction:&lt;/strong&gt; Psychosocial factors and fatigue are significant factors in nurses&amp;rsquo; performance. Since the relationship between psychosocial factors and fatigue has been rarely studied, the aim of this study was investigating the relationship between psychosocial work factors and fatigue among nurses.&lt;br&gt;
&lt;strong&gt;Method:&lt;/strong&gt; In this cross-sectional study, 270 nurses from hospitals of Urmia University of Medical Sciences randomly participated. The Job Content Questionnaire and Swedish Occupational Fatigue Inventory were used for data collection. Pearson&amp;rsquo;s correlation coefficient and Structural Equation Modeling were used for data analysis.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; The mean (SD) of control was 66&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;32 (7&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;36), psychological job demand 35&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;47 (3&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;68), social support 22&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;31 (2&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;64), physical job demand 15&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;22 (2&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;18), and job insecurity 8&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;72 (4&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t;06). Control and social support dimensions had low levels. Moreover, psychological and physical job demand had high levels, which indicates a high stress level. According to the results, psychological and physical job demand had a significant relationship with all dimensions of fatigue (P &lt; 0.001).&lt;br&gt;
&lt;strong&gt;Conclusions:&lt;/strong&gt; The majority of nurses were exposed to high levels of job stress. Among psychosocial factors, physical demand was identified as the most effective factor on fatigue. Any comprehensive interventional program regarding psychosocial work factor in order to reduce job stress and fatigue can improve health care quality and also prevent medical errors.&lt;br&gt;

						<title>Design and Cross-Validation of Six-Minute Walk Test (6MWT) Prediction Equation in Iranian healthy Males Aged 7 to 16 Years</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=352&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;p style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ction:&lt;/strong&gt; Application and correct interpretation of the 6-minute walk test (6MWT) in medical, therapeutic, and exercise settings requires normal values of the 6MWT. The aim of this study was to develop and cross-validate the 6MWT prediction equation in Iranian healthy children and adolescent males.&lt;br&gt;
&lt;strong&gt;Methods&lt;/strong&gt;&lt;strong&gt;:&lt;/strong&gt; The 6MWT and anthropometric variables were measured in 391 males (8 to 17 years old) with standard methods. Pearson correlation was used to assess the relationship between distances walked in the 6MWT and independent variables. Multiple regression analysis was used to design 6MWT prediction equation from dependent variables. Furthermore, accuracy of the present 6MWT prediction equation was cross-validated.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; Significant correlation was found between distances walked in the 6MWT and anthropometric characteristics (P &lt; 0.001). Multiple stepwise regression reviled that age and Body Mass Index (BMI) could explain 63% of the variability of 6MWT in children and adolescent males (r&lt;sup&gt;2&lt;/sup&gt;= 0.627, SEE= 36 m, P &lt; 0.001). Accuracy of native 6MWT prediction equation was approved by good correlation between measured and predicted distance walked in the 6MWT (r&lt;sup&gt;2&lt;/sup&gt; = 0.79, P &lt; 0.001).&lt;br&gt;
&lt;strong&gt;Conclusions:&lt;/strong&gt; This is the first study on the development of native 6MWD reference values. With application of this 6MWD prediction equation, physicians, physical therapists, and fitness coaches could receive correct feedback of pharmacological, rehabilitation, and exercise interventions.&lt;/p&gt;

						<title>Identifying Dimensions of Organizational Culture Affecting Job Motivations in Public Libraries in Iran: A Qualitative Research</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=407&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;p style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ction:&lt;/strong&gt; Job motivation as one of the factors that affect the behavior of librarians can improve their performance. Considering that organizational culture is one of the factors influencing job motivation, the aim of this study was to identify dimensions of organizational culture that can affect job motivation of librarians in public libraries of Iran.&lt;br&gt;
&lt;strong&gt;Methods: &lt;/strong&gt;This qualitative study was conducted using content analysis. Using the purposive sampling, 19 people of librarians of public libraries in 10 provinces were interviewed using depth and semi-structured interviews. After extracting the primary codes, they classifyied into three dimmensions and eight components.&lt;br&gt;
&lt;strong&gt;Results: &lt;/strong&gt;Based on the results of this study, dimmensions of organizational culture, which can affect job motivation included knowledge-oriented and capability-oriented culture (professionalism and meritocracy, professional capability, use of technology, and organizational learning), independency culture (non-politicization in the library, and decentralization), and participatory and motivational leadership culture (participatory management, and motivational management).&lt;br&gt;
&amp;nbsp;In view of nature and social roles of public libraries and broad impressive factors on them, these models have limitations to assess status of organizational culture in public libraries. So, it is necessary to identify dimensions and components of effective organizational culture in public libraries of Iran and then manage the organizational culture on the basis of this effective culture.&lt;br&gt;
&lt;strong&gt;Conclusions: &lt;/strong&gt;Dimensions and components of effective organizational culture resulted from this study can be used as an ideal model for managing organizational culture or efforts to rule these cultural components in the public library of Iran.&lt;/p&gt;

						<title>The Mediating Role of Sleep Quality in Relationship between Workload and Physical and Mental Health among Nurses</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=395&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;p style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ction: &lt;/strong&gt;Nurses as the most important part of human resources in the health service system are often faced with problems associated with shift work. The present study aimed to examine a mediating role of sleep quality in the relationship between workload and physical and mental health among nurses.&lt;br&gt;
&lt;strong&gt;Methods:&lt;/strong&gt; This cross-sectional study was conducted on 236 nurses working in three educational hospitals in Bojnord city. To collect data, the survey of shiftworkers (SOS) questionnaire was used. Data were analyzed using the structural equation modeling by AMOS-21 and SPSS 19 software packages. In addition, the Preacher and Hayes&amp;rsquo; SPSS Macro program was used for testing mediation.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; The results showed that the proposed model fitted the data properly&lt;span dir=&quot;RTL&quot;&gt;.&lt;/span&gt; Also, workload directly affected only physical health, and the quality of sleep had a mediator role in the relationship between workload and physical and mental health.&lt;br&gt;
&lt;strong&gt;Conclusions: &lt;/strong&gt;Sleep quality as an important variable can mediate the relationship between workload and physical and mental health in nurses. So, it is suggested that interventional interventions to improve the health of the staff be focused on adjusting and shifting job shifts and teaching the principles of sleep hygiene to them.&lt;br&gt;

						<title>The Effects of Lighting on Mental and Cognitive Performance: A Structured Systematic Review</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=358&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;p style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ction:&lt;/strong&gt; Lighting affects many non-visual functions such as Circadian rhythm, alertness, core body temperature, hormone secretion and sleep. The aim of this study was to investigate the effects of lighting on human cognitive and mental performance.&lt;br&gt;
&lt;strong&gt;Methods: &lt;/strong&gt;In this systematic review, databases including ISI Web of Knowledge, Scopus, PubMed and Science Direct were searched to access the relevant studies. The search was performed using the keywords &amp;quot;Lighting&amp;quot; and &amp;quot;Illumination&amp;quot; and &amp;quot;Cognitive Performance&amp;quot;, &amp;quot;Mental Performance&amp;quot;, &amp;quot;Memory &amp;quot;, &amp;quot;Attention&amp;quot;, and &amp;quot;Concentration&amp;quot; by title, keyword and abstracts of articles published in mentioned databases from 2010 to 2016.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; Lighting affects human cognitive performance in three areas of psycho-cognitive (visual comfort, visual perception, color recognition, identification of symbols, attention, working memory, learning, reaction time and brain function), biocognitive area (alertness, mood, vitality, subjective feelings, motivation, well-being and quality of sleep) and mental workload (amount of workload, psychological stress, and mental fatigue). The best light to regulate cognitive, biological (circadian rhythm) and mental processes is bright daylight in the morning with a short wavelength (wavelength 420-480 nm) and high intensity (1000lx).&lt;br&gt;
&lt;strong&gt;Conclusions:&lt;/strong&gt; Lighting design in addition to providing comfort and visual needs should provide the non-visual and cognitive needs such as attention, alertness, mood, sleep quality and decrease mental fatigue and eventually well-bing.&lt;/p&gt;

						<title>Ergonomically Adjustable Laptop Desk Designed Based on Anthropometric Characteristics of 20-30 Year-Old Students of Mazandaran University of Medical Sciences</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=355&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;div style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ction:&lt;/strong&gt; In recent years, with the progressive development of various scientific, research and industrial fields, there are musculoskeletal disorders in computer and laptop users. Musculoskeletal disorders including pain and pressure in areas such as wrists, elbows, neck and shoulders, along with the fatigue of these areas, especially back and waist pain are common among many computer and laptop users. The aim of this study was to design a customizable ergonomic table for using laptops based on the anthropometric characteristics of students of Mazandaran University of Medical Sciences.&lt;br&gt;
&lt;strong&gt;Methods:&lt;/strong&gt; This study was conducted on 108 (61 males and 47 females) students of Mazandaran University of Medical Sciences. Ten parameters including knee height sitting on a chair, eyes- elbows height, cross-legged posture kneeling length, cross-legged posture kneeling height, thick thighs, elbow rest height-sitting, shoulder-fingertip length, abdominal depth, hip breath, and elbow-fingertip length were measured using the adjustable seating, caliper and meter. The SPSS software version 20 was used to analyze the data. Then, the percentiles 1 to 99 and the golden number 1.618 were used to design the table.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; The mean age of the subjects was 23 &amp;plusmn; 3.14 years. Based on anthropometric characteristics, gold number, resulting percentiles and design equations, an adjustable ergonomic table was designed in three seated sitting, four-knee and Fowler&amp;rsquo;s positions.&lt;br&gt;
&lt;strong&gt;Conclusions: &lt;/strong&gt;It is expected that after putting this device on the laptop, the musculoskeletal disorders caused by its use will be reduced. Because of limited studies have been conducted in this area, it is suggested that further studies in this regard be undertaken in the future.&lt;/div&gt;

						<title>Ergonomic Design and Evaluation of Fabric Cutting Scissors with Regard to Pinch Force and Wrist Posture</title>
						<link>http://iehfs.ir/journal/browse.php?a_id=349&amp;sid=1&amp;slc_lang=en</link>
						<description>&lt;div style=&quot;text-align: justify;&quot;&gt;&lt;strong&gt;Introduction:&lt;/strong&gt; Scissors are essential tools in different occupations including sewing and clothes making. Improper design of fabric cutting scissors can lead to the development of musculoskeletal symptoms among users. The aim of this study was to evaluate pinch force and wrist posture while working with three designs of sewing scissors and a traditional sewing scissors.&lt;br&gt;
&lt;strong&gt;Methods:&lt;/strong&gt; The first model of the scissor had a bent-handle (to improve wrist posture), the second model had a thumb-ring that was located closer to the pivot (to reduce thumb&amp;rsquo;s abducted position and range of movement), and the original oval ring in the third model was changed to a hook-shaped handle (to reduce hand and finger discomfort). Pinch force was measured using a pinch gauge and wrist posture was measured in two anatomical planes including flexion/extension and ulnar/radial deviation using the observational method.&lt;br&gt;
&lt;strong&gt;Results:&lt;/strong&gt; The results showed significant effects of scissors&amp;#39; design on pinch force exertions (P &lt; 0.01) and ulnar/radial deviation of the wrist (P &lt; 0.001). The lowest level of pinch force decrement between pre- and post-pinch force measurements was recorded for the second model (2.4%), while the highest level was recorded for the traditional model (7%). More neutral wrist postures in ulnar/radial direction (83%) were recorded for the first model compared to the other designs.&lt;br&gt;
&lt;strong&gt;Conclusions:&lt;/strong&gt; The second scissors, which was designed to reduce thumb&amp;rsquo;s range of motion and abduction, showed some improvement in pinch force compared to the traditional model.&lt;/div&gt;
